14、 precedence. Nothing in this document, however, supersedes applicable laws and regulations unless a specific exemption has been obtained. 3. REQUIREMENTS 3.1 First article. When specified (see 6.2), a sample shall be subjected to first article inspection in accordance with 4.1.1. 3.2 Design and cons
15、truction. The pump shall be designed and constructed as specified in Drawing 12292104, and shall be in accordance with 3.2.1 and 3.2.1.1. 3.2.1 Electric motor. The pump shall have an enclosed waterproof electric motor which shall be rated at 28 volts direct current (Vdc). 3.2.1.1 Bearings. The motor
16、 shall have anti-friction, lubricated for life, sealed bearings, rated for continuous duty. 3.3 Materials. Materials used in the fabrication of the pump shall be as specified herein and in referenced drawings. When not thereby specified, the materials shall be in accordance with the manufacturers sp
17、ecifications for submersible pumps, as long as those materials are capable of meeting all the operating, support and ownership, and environmental requirements as specified herein. 3.3.1 Hazardous materials. Asbestos and cadmium materials shall not be used in any form in any part of the vehicle. No i
18、tem, part or assembly shall contain radioactive materials in which the specific activity is greater than 0.002 microcuries per gram or activity per item equals or exceeds 0.01 microcuries. 3 -3.2 Recycled. recovered, or environmentally preferable materials. Recycled, recovered, or environmentally pr
19、eferable materials should be used to the maximum extent possible provided that the material meets or exceeds the operational and maintenance requirements, and promotes economically advantageous life cycle costs. 3 Provided by IHSNot for ResaleNo reproduction or networking permitted without license f
20、rom IHS-,-,-9999906 2075644 905 MIL-DTL-624 1 5B(AT) 3.4 Omrating reauirements. 3.4.1 Overall performance. When operated at 28 i 0.05 Vdc at any indicated head pressure, the pump output (flow) and current consumption shall be as specified in figure 1. 3.4.2 Water level. The pump shall start to deliv
21、er water when the depth of water is not more than 7.5 centimeters (cm) (3 inches (in.), above the pump mounting surface. The pump may stop delivering water when the depth of water is not more than 7 cm (2.75 in.), above the pump mounting surface. 3.4.3 Pumping capacity. The pump shall deliver not le
